21xrx.com
2024-05-19 15:35:24 Sunday
登录
文章检索 我的文章 写文章
C语言:从面向过程到面向对象的转变
2023-06-19 10:24:57 深夜i     --     --
C语言 面向对象 面向过程 程序设计 编程方式

C语言是一种广泛应用于系统开发和嵌入式系统开发的程序设计语言,最早由贝尔实验室的Dennis Ritchie在1972年开发而成。它的初衷是为了开发Unix操作系统,但随着时间的推移,C语言逐渐被应用于更广泛的领域。

C语言最初是一种面向过程的程序设计语言,主要强调程序执行的顺序和操作。但是,随着软件复杂度的提高,这种方式逐渐显得不够灵活,于是人们开始探索面向对象的程序设计方式。在面向对象的程序设计中,程序被看做一组交互的对象,每个对象都有自己的状态和行为。

为了满足软件开发的需求,C++语言在C语言的基础上添加了面向对象的特性,成为了一种更加强大和灵活的程序设计语言。但是,C语言也在不断地向面向对象的方向发展,现在已经可以使用结构体、指针等方式来实现面向对象的编程方式。

在日常生活中,我们经常使用到许多应用程序和游戏,这些程序都是由C语言编写而成的。C语言的面向对象特性为软件开发和系统设计提供了更多的灵活性和可维护性,同时也为程序员提供了更多的编程选择。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复